This print by Thomas Stevens takes us back to the historic battlefield scene in Wellington & Blugher [sic], England, during the late 19th century. The image showcases two legendary figures of military history - the Duke of Wellington and Field Marshal Blucher. Both men played pivotal roles in defeating Napoleon Bonaparte at the Battle of Waterloo. The photograph captures a moment frozen in time, with the Duke of Wellington and Field Marshal Blucher mounted on their majestic horses. Their commanding presence is evident as they survey the aftermath of battle, surrounded by soldiers and fellow horsemen.
